The correlation between historical prices or returns on Evaluator Growth Rms and Rational Strategic is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Rational Strategic Allocation are associated (or correlated) with Evaluator Growth.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Evaluator Growth Rms has no effect on the direction of Rational Strategic i.e., Rational Strategic and Evaluator Growth go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with Rational Strategic and Evaluator Growth
The main advantage of trading using opposite Rational Strategic and Evaluator Growth posit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Rational Strategic position performs unexpectedly, Evaluator Growth can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
